Rebecca is an actor and filmmaker born “off Broadway” in New York City, and she has been performing from an early age. She made her stage debut at ten in Dublin as the title character in Annie, later taking on roles such as Anne in The Diary of Anne Frank, Sandy in Grease, Mayzie in Seussical, and Belle in Disney’s Beauty and the Beast. She grew up primarily in New Zealand and went on to complete a Bachelor of Performing and Screen Arts in Auckland, leading to early guest star roles on Power Rangers and Shortland Street. Shortly after relocating to Los Angeles, she booked her first American feature lead, playing Brit in the thriller Quarries. Rebecca has continued to build a diverse body of work across film and television while also creating her own projects. Her short films Bad Kiwis and Bad Kiwis 2: Kiwi Driver—which she co-wrote, produced, directed, and starred in—have been recognized at festivals throughout the United States, with a third installment underway.
